Abstract Movable heat preservation tank covers are symmetrically distributed on the two sides of a fixed heat preservation tank cover, the inner ends of the movable heat preservation tank covers are hinged to the fixed heat preservation tank cover through hinges, and the outer ends of the movable heat preservation tank covers are in lap joint with the upper edge of the electrolytic cell. The supporting plate is fixedly arranged right above the fixed heat preservation tank cover through the supporting columns, and the anode conductive rod penetrates through the fixed heat preservation tank cover in a sealed mode; the winch is fixedly installed on the supporting plate, one end of the steel wire rope is wound and connected to a winch of the winch, and the other end of the steel wire rope is fixedly connected to the movable heat preservation tank cover; the smoke inlet ends of the branch discharge flues penetrate through the fixed heat preservation tank cover in a sealed mode to be communicated with the interior of the el
